Miscrowave Custard Sauce

Here's my standby recipe - I make this with many things where you might use whipping cream or ice cream. My family loves it! I nearly always double the recipe. It's great with the peach dumplings I posted under the Elberta Peach thread.

1 1/4 cups milk
3-4 T sugar
1 T cornstarch

1 beaten egg yolk
1 tsp vanilla

Mix milk, sugar and cornstarch thoroughly in a microwave safe bowl (like a big glass measuring cup). Heat in the microwave until boiling. Add a little of the hot mixture to the beaten egg in a separate dish and combine and then pour the mix back into the entire hot mixture and mix well. Microwave again until the entire mixture boils - this part only takes a short time. Add vanilla and mix well. Serve warm or chilled.
